Gorges du Fier

One of the most popular tourist attractions in Annecy, Gorges du Fier is a gorge carved by the Fier River. The best way to appreciate this natural beauty is on a trail that runs on the cliffs. People suffering from vertigo should not take the hike. It is also not stroller-friendly and it is recommended that walkers wear comfortable shoes.

The Fier River is 25 meters away from the walking path. It measures 250 meters long. This lets the walkers observe the incredible work of erosion that has created this landscape over millennia. Some of the rocks have been shaped into animals or faces, while others are different shades. The Fier River has carved many "Marmites de Geants" large stone holes, into the rocks.

This beautiful hiking trail is a must-see for anyone visiting the area. It's not hard to access you just need to head to the west from Annecy and then take the D116 to Lovagny. Parking is free close to the Gorges and in the smaller parking lot next to Chateau Montrottier. Depending on the time of day, these spaces are likely to fill up quickly, so it is essential to arrive early.

The trail is mostly asphalted but there are a few sections that follow cliffs in the gorge. It is not recommended for those with mobility issues or young children, but it is an excellent spot to snap photos and appreciate the scenery. It is recommended to visit the park in the morning, when it is cooler and there is less wind.

The Gorges du Fier are a unique experience. It's not just an amazing natural beauty, but it is it's also an interesting historical place. A legend from the Middle Ages tells of Diane, a young countess, who was married to a wealthy Count of Montrottier. The Countess was a fan of the handsome knight Pontverre and often strolled along the gorges with him. She was devastated by the betrayal and took her own life at the Gorges du Fier.
